True: the vast majority of Nikes, Pumas, Adidas etc are made by independent factories under contract. Often, these factories or a handful of people in then make some "extra" shoes over and above what they are contracted for, then send them to unofficial distribution channels. Legally, the shoes are "fake", but they are literally technically identical to the real deal. Almost as real, some factories bribe people in winning factories to send spec sheets: these are detailed technical drawings, materials needs and at times recommended manufacturing techniques. As long as you can source the materials (tricky but not impossible with Adidas Boost material), you can make a near perfect replica, much more accurate than reverse engineering the shoe.

if you had a factory that could make 1000 pair a day but nike only wanted 800 pair a day you would run the extra 200 and sell them out the backdoor. this has been done for ages. You also sell the ones that dont quite make the nike quality standard instead of destroy them. You also might know cheaper shortcut that nike would not accept but that doesn't affect the look of the product so you do the shortcut and sell those too.
